通知说明
在进行异步通知交互时,如果GEP收到的应答不是 OK (webhook通知除外,webhook通知时http status=200表示接收成功) ,GEP会认为通知失败,会通过一定的策略重新发起通知。
👉通知策略
通知次数:10次
通知的间隔频率(分钟):0*2m、1*2m、2*2m、3*2m、4*2m、5*2m、6*2m、7*2m、8*2m、9*2m商户设置的异步地址建议不要有特殊字符,如空格、HTML 标签等,且不能重定向。(如果重定向,会导致收不到 OK 字符,会被服务器判定为该页面程序运行出现异常,而重发处理结果通知)
GEP是用 POST 方式发送通知信息,商户获取参数的方式如下:request.Form(“dataContent”)、$_POST[‘dataContent’]、request.getParameter(“dataContent”)等。
GEP针对同一条异步通知重试时,异步通知参数是不变的,商户需要做好重复通知处理,同样的请求参数只需要处理一次
通知地址
参考对应接口说明
通知参数
序号 | 域名 | 变量名 | 必填 | 字段类型 | 备注 |
---|---|---|---|---|---|
01. | 版本编号 | version | M | String(6) | 1.0.0 |
02. | 证书编号 | certificateId | M | Number | GEP提供给代理商的证书编号 |
03. | 代理商编号 | agentNo | M | Number | GEP提供给代理商的唯一编号 |
04. | 用户编号 | userno | C | Number | 在GEP系统开通的唯一商户编号 |
05. | 数据类型 | dataType | M | String(8) | JSON |
06. | 加密数据 | dataContent | M | String(2048) | 具体参数参考接口文档中的 加密数据dataContent 说明 解密方法参考 加解密说明 |
通知示例
{
"agentNo": "5182210819000222768",
"certificateId": "2103021706000005085",
"errorMsg": "受理成功",
"dataContent": "459413c733b3e11fbb5de0a0b56088b5240994e9c9f640647fea863155c67adc74040a6e740e7e13c75746659f0db2d4ed4faa4879996b11e934fb9a7a6982f1f66e2cfac2bcf2cf1bcd6d4c1c6dfc9871d20083bbe167dc9a5b11da36b15e6f8cc679a758a99ec11dd3c66239a23027fa993f9f99d46b2886f688e02941eea37f31034fabf651263667a9d2713f5f5488b01abb6058fca9df3e26af5dd5035056308bcc7f478375ef7082cad02bea83f77c99c7bb7ccf457bfca8a6c3c8b5051768df85be8a806da81fcb7005aa5246bc111c7f2eb75152fa1d32327252bdd0f1ea1fe257ed75edff1e5704e49550400ecef2e5bc985a1a21b7565f0ebe972fa14cc030ca2c5223901cadf9b7d47c78c7901742bb0ef610849088cce24f1b5afe4554ae881031079562e295ddf996a2dedcc06156f57f8d3175dfedb6ac55a0cc1d74530650e7be82fc655c08b432ea0835bdfc4a3329987bb3f6a7edebcb33ce9a0673916af8a586d16dfaae1a975add3eeb25cefc050f26c0f336ec2b182b010e243bec12d35f88326e184278eb2ab6c87e3c188d4cc7812aaa9c6c2e6a27595cb7dbe56c6a07a90b37277c579dbaaa742e8d567a8ac307feddfe78149bcdf7ff4734e79ad52674540ee0d2b0aeae790bf2d27b926ee090c9dda74d1fdbef60378a431b68c46df459a2e482db75a4a1ef862023753cd5db2bf53e4da37c7b0feeb87c972c0404665c93de3fcfc38a96bc5535d4dd4c5acf12f58b2c37e348235aa0b3293ecc0cd77cd30fb65c91aef9440b6cc2be6c18598878197e0e9939859351e38e455cbd6e162948db37543390946243ad8c68147f7495e7e9ec1a4cfde6c51bf66dbd85b07e8009cf50709dad219462974083e315ec4ffca929e4ca8478905dd23686b0e667660701503094b0fe12e2eaea1674e2558d6ea4bae0033c278f75bbfa4664ae1b4dff2cd9ada68ee493d7fd7aa93816429d807ca50aa81ff6f71d8f5a8f7ef4d4d545d65749186106e47ad804902122b05000fd0c79056675eaa9bf0eafab7677231b02e06f04f4feb5235184108b6442d9484110a683",
"success": true,
"userNo": "5181200720000136338"
}